Spring Creek's climate presents specific storage considerations. Our humid summers and occasionally cold winters mean that proper ventilation and protection from the elements are essential. When evaluating storage facilities, look for options that offer covered or enclosed RV boat storage. This protects your boat's exterior, upholstery, and electronics from sun damage, rain, and potential freezing temperatures. Many local facilities understand these needs and provide climate-controlled units, which are ideal for preventing mold and mildew in our region's humidity.
Given Spring Creek's proximity to major waterways, convenience is key. The best RV boat storage facilities are those that offer easy in-and-out access, allowing you to hitch up and head to the ramp without hassle. Look for facilities with wide driveways and ample maneuvering space, especially if you have a larger RV and boat combo. Some storage providers in the area even offer additional amenities like dump stations, water fill-ups, or basic maintenance areas, which can be incredibly valuable for last-minute preparations before hitting the water.
Security is another vital factor. Your boat is a significant investment, so inquire about features like gated access, surveillance cameras, and on-site management. Many storage facilities in the Spring Creek area take pride in offering peace of mind through robust security measures. Don't hesitate to visit potential sites in person to assess the overall condition and security firsthand.
